A man purchased a magazine at the airport for $2.79. The tax on the purchase was $0.12 What is the tax rate at the airport?
The tax rate is
% (Round to the nearest percent as needed.)

Answer:

4 percent.

Explanation:

To solve this problem we have to find the percent $0.12 is of $2.79.

0.12 = x * 2.79

0.12 divided by 2.79 = 0.04301075268

We have to round to the nearest percent, so that's 0.04, or 4 percent.

The tax rate at the airport is 4 percent.
